Stephen Colbert Interviews Jeff Tweedy of Wilco, Who Also Perform a New Song


(Wilco - "The Wilco Song" - Live on "The Colbert Report")

Jeff Tweedy, frontman of Wilco (who also performed) and self-described "really lousy capitalist"--what, he doesn't remember the car commercials--recently stopped by the set of the late night faux-punditry late night comedy powerhouse "The Colbert Report" to discuss the free giveaway song from their website, potential nom de rock's of Tweedy's, and the possibility of playing an Obama inauguration. To which Tweedy replies with a priceless anecdote about what Obama himself said when Wilco asked him that question.

Wilco also performed a new song called, um, "Wilco The Song", a new, exclusive track that starts out sounding like The Velvet Underground before entering more familiar alt-country territory. Video: Nas Performs Anti-Fox News Song on "The Colbert Report"


(Nas - "Sly Fox" - Live on "The Colbert Report")

Rapper Nas, who just released his chart-topping Untitled, is interviewed by, then performs for, TV's best satirist. The impetus behind all this attention is undoubtedly driven by the fact that Nas recently took part in delivering a petition to the Fox News Network. The petition demands that Fox discontinue what they perceive as negative attacks on people of color, specifically Obama. But its "Fox and Friends", Colbert hilariously protests. Then, Nas explains his reasons behind supporting the boycott, and performs "Sly Fox", a protest anthem against the cable news network, off his latest record.

The Roots Play "The Colbert Report" - Plus New Video for "Birthday Girl"



Speaking of musicians, hip-hop, and Philadelphia, local heroes The Roots were the house band of sorts on "The Colbert Report" last night, where they played homage to Jimi Hendrix with a smashing--literally--rendition of our nation's anthem. Colbert's been doing his show live all this week, so everything you're watching is in real time.

In other Roots video news, the band released its video for Rising Down reject "Birthday Girl" starring porn star Sasha Grey. Watch that video below (possibly NSFW):
